Post by: CliffordK on 30/03/2011 18:35:41
Personally I didn't pay much attention to it.

Many of these programs have little overall impact.

I doubt the power generators can do very well with compensating for hour-by-hour power fluctuations, although I assume they can anticipate diurnal and weekly usage patterns.

As far as "don't fill your gas tanks on Tuesday type announcements.  They are effective if more people ride their bicycles on Tuesday, but ineffective if people instead choose to get a fill-up on Monday or Wednesday.
